Picture Windows

A single large glass panel can provide a way to conserve energy and offer you a scenic view of the outside as long as the glass is a Low-E variant. A picture window’s panel design maximizes the glass area and minimizes the frame’s cover space, allowing more sunlight to enter your household. Casement Windows

This window design provides proper ventilation thanks to its panels that easily open. Because of its design, it can be placed anywhere in the household, though most homeowners in Nashville prefer an area where immediate ventilation is necessary, such as the kitchen. Sliding Windows

These easy-to-use windows allow you to close and open your windows with its cascading track. This window style best suits rooms with a restriction on space.
